<p>Explore the world of scientific discovery with Science Volume n.s. July-Dec 1911 a fascinating compilation of scientific research and discourse from the early 20th century. Edited by John Michels this volume offers a unique glimpse into the scientific landscape of its time presenting a diverse range of articles and findings that reflect the intellectual curiosity and innovation of the era.</p> <p>This volume preserves a significant record of scientific thought and progress making it an invaluable resource for historians of science researchers and anyone interested in the evolution of scientific knowledge.
